My mother only had one eye. I never wanted her to show up in my school. One day during my primary school, I was terribly ill and my mother came. ¡°Your mother only has one eye!¡± Some of my classmates yelled(º°½Ð). I wished my mother would just disappear(Ïûʧ). I shouted at her, taking no notice of the sad look on her face. My mother just handed me some medicine and left without saying anything.
At that time, I didn¡¯t think I had hurt her feelings. That night I saw my mother crying in her room. Even so, I hated her tears from one eye. I made a decision: I must study hard and leave my mother.
Years later my dream came true. I was quite successful. I never thought of going back to see my ¡°ugly¡± mother until one day I got a letter.
¡°My son I¡¯m sorry I only have one eye. When you were little, you had an accident and lost your eye. I couldn¡¯t stand watching you live with only one eye. So I gave mine to you. I never regretted doing it because I love you.¡± I cried out aloud. Only then did I realize how beautiful my mother¡¯s eye was!
